While there are plenty of things that can prevent proper operation of a lawn mower engine, these symptoms often point to the carburetor. When a carburetor is clean and working correctly, the engine should start easily, idle smoothly, accelerate without stumbling and run with normal fuel economy.
This ever-so-important part commonly requires a bit of TLC rather than an entire replacement. Here are nine tips to help clean and maintain your carburetor for proper engine performance.
